    • @ImmortanDan
      @ImmortanDan 10 місяців тому +7

      Gearing is the big answer: while the bmw has 200tq less, the power difference is much smaller, and as long as you have sufficiently short gearing that's all that matters for acceleration.
      It's also possible that the BMW had more favorable suspension geometry and weight distribution for a hard launch; the review here does say the Mustang is front-heavy (and sure enough, those twin-cam Modulars with tons of stroke were total boat anchors) so it's really no surprise that it can't put enough weight on the rear tires.
